Description

Fmoc-Ile-n-Carboxyanhydride is a specialized, high-purity amino acid derivative used as a key building block in solid-phase peptide synthesis (SPPS). This compound matters because it enables the efficient, racemization-free incorporation of isoleucine into peptide chains under mild conditions, which is critical for producing complex peptides with high fidelity. It is primarily needed by research institutions, pharmaceutical R&D departments, and fine chemical manufacturers engaged in the development of therapeutic peptides, peptide hormones, and biochemical tools. Application

  • Solid-Phase Peptide Synthesis (SPPS): As an activated amino acid derivative for the sequential coupling of isoleucine residues.
  • Pharmaceutical R&D: For the research and development of novel peptide-based therapeutics and drug candidates.
  • Combinatorial Chemistry: Used in libraries for high-throughput screening to discover new bioactive peptides.
  • Bioconjugation: In the site-specific modification of peptides and proteins for diagnostic or therapeutic purposes.
  • Academic Research: For fundamental studies in biochemistry, medicinal chemistry, and chemical biology involving peptide structures.
  • Production of Custom Peptides: By CROs (Contract Research Organizations) and CDMOs (Contract Development and Manufacturing Organizations) for client-specific projects.

Storage

Preserve in a tightly closed container, protected from light. Store at -20°C or below under an inert atmosphere (e.g., argon or nitrogen) due to its moisture-sensitive (hygroscopic) nature. Allow the sealed container to equilibrate to room temperature before opening to minimize condensation and hydrolysis. For long-term stability, desiccants are recommended within the storage environment.
